Output 121fd7142fbfa10229554a4efc52e521f7bfd85bb1569f4eb7efab6bfa1663c9:1

value
349240882
script pubkey
OP_0 OP_PUSHBYTES_20 1fd752291940499126770ba27fc5d36af16822c3
address
bc1qrlt4y2gegpyezfnhpw38l3wndtcksgkrlzgfrz
transaction
121fd7142fbfa10229554a4efc52e521f7bfd85bb1569f4eb7efab6bfa1663c9
confirmations
371092
spent
true